Hmm I dont agree:

"Mid-November
First decisions are transmitted to UCAS. Further decisions are sent to UCAS on a weekly basis. You should check UCAS Track regularly for the latest update on your application.


Mid-November to mid-February
Some departments adopt a gathered field approach when considering some applications. If your application is part of this gathered field you will be notified by email."
This means that if you have been rejected you find out, but it is rolling admissions, people have got offers at my school (3 ppl all in different weeks).
